You will provide this technical cost perspective to provide oversight and strategically guide a team of consultants in developing reliable and predictable cost models for our data centers. The responsibilities of this role also include prioritizing, developing and supporting a wide range of cost initiatives in a highly collaborative environment and effectively communicating this information in a timely manner across many stakeholders.
Estimating Manager, MEP - Data Center Design, Engineering, and Construction Responsibilities:
- Estimating for complex program, project, and system level budgets formed from historical cost metrics, industry cost benchmarks, market cost analytics, and from personal cost estimating experience
- Lead cost reviews within Project Planning that include 5-10 large complex project designs per year and smaller initiative and projects on a weekly basis
- Develop internal processes and initiatives around cost estimation that leverage internal cost data, resources and current market information from external vendors
- Provide reconciliation analysis between projects and estimate revisions, including supporting pre-construction teams in negotiations with general contractors for projects that range from $10 million to $2+ billion dollars
- Leverage third party tools and cost consultants to prepare estimates through multiple stages of project development in a time-sensitive environment
- Some domestic and international travel may be required
- 10+ years of experience in construction management and estimating
- 7+ years of cost estimating experience in mission critical facilities or large and complex projects, that includes MEP estimating
- Experience in managing vendor relationships and working with stakeholders, both internal and external, to gather technical project requirements to inform cost
- Experience in communicating and presenting cost estimates to a group of stakeholders at all levels of an organization
